Loss of thousands of district nurses under Cameron has been felt in every community - Andrew Gwynne

Andrew Gwynne MP, Labour’s Shadow Health Minister, responding to the Royal College of Nursing’s warning on district nurse shortages, said:

“The loss of thousands of district nurses under David Cameron has been felt in every community. Fewer elderly people are now receiving support at home that helped them stay living independently.

“The NHS is forced to pick up the tab and is now spending hundreds of millions on keeping people in hospital when they don’t need to be there, money that would be better spent on nursing staff and more support at home.
